#860e58 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#860e58 is composed of 52.5% red, 5.5%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 89.6% magenta, 34.3% yellow and 47.5% black. It has a hue angle of 323 degrees, a saturation of 81.1% and a lightness of 29%. #860e58 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ff1cb0 with #0d0000. Closest websafe color is: #990066.

● #860e58 color description : Dark pink.
#860e58 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#860e58 has RGB values of R:134, G:14,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.9, Y:0.34, K:0.47. Its decimal value is 8785496.

Shades and Tints of #860e58
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0106 is the darkest color, while #fef7f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#860e58
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4d474b is the less saturated color, while #91035b is the most saturated one.
